Informationen zum Autor Michael Bond was born in Newbury! Berkshire in 1926 and started writing whilst serving in the army during the Second World War. In 1958 the first book featuring his most famous creation! Paddington Bear! was published and many stories of his adventures followed. In 1983 he turned his hand to adult fiction and the detective cum gastronome par excellence Monsieur Pamplemousse was born. Michael Bond was awarded the OBE in 1997 and in 2007 was made an Honorary Doctor of Letters by Reading University. He is married! with two grown-up children! and lives in London. Zusammenfassung Monsieur Pamplemousse finds himself in deep water when an unfortunate collision with a Mother Superior is caught on camera. To avoid media attention! he is sent to report on Chef Andre Dulac! currently in line for Le Guide's top award! and opens a can of worms which threatens the very sanctity of France s premier gastronomic bible.
